Key Participant Recruitment for Effective UX Research

Conducting effective UX research hinges on assembling a diverse and representative pool of participants. Carefully recruiting participants who align with your research goals is paramount to ensuring reliable insights. A well-defined participant profile, encompassing demographics, user behaviors, and motivations, can direct your recruitment strategy. Leverage a variety of platforms to cast a wide net, including online panels, social media groups, and direct outreach. Remember to incentivize participation to attract and retain qualified individuals. By implementing a robust participant recruitment process, you can enhance the effectiveness of your UX research and drive data-driven design decisions.

Maximizing Survey Response Rates: Best Practices and Strategies

Securing a high response rate for your survey is crucial for obtaining valuable insights. Employing best practices can significantly improve your chances of success. First, carefully design your survey to be brief, engaging, and easy to interpret. Explicitly explain the purpose of the survey and promise respondents that their input will be protected.

To maximize response rates, evaluate offering a small gift for finishing the survey. Send reminders to non-respondents, and personalize your communication to increase interest. Finally, distribute your survey through multiple platforms to reach a wider audience.
